Abstract

A planar antenna design for ultra-wideband (UWB) communication with two additional GSM bands is presented in this study. A beveled-shaped patch with a quarter-wavelength transformer is utilized to provide UWB response. Two capacitive-loaded resonators (CLRs) are utilized in conjunction with a partial ground plane to create resonance in the GSM frequency bands (900 and 1800 MHz). The designed antennas' prototype is fabricated and measured, and it is noticed that both the results are well in agreement. Furthermore, the proposed antenna design produces good radiation characteristics for the bands of interests.
